A total of 197 traffic volunteers, farmers, and tour guides in Atimonan, Quezon received medical services through the GMA Kapuso Foundation on Labor Day. 

According to "24 Oras" Friday, the traffic volunteers stationed alongside the Old Zigzag Road connecting Pagbilao and Atimonan assist motorists and help them navigate the dangerous road. 

Among them is 63-year-old Lorna Escullar, who has been a traffic volunteer for more than two decades. While there is no certainty when it comes to how much she earns daily, she remains committed to her work as a volunteer. 

"Minsan ay 150 lang kami, masaya kami kahit piso lang," she said. 

Another traffic volunteer, Josephine Sarte, uses her earnings from the work to help with the expenses of her child in college. 

"Bilang volunteers po, so literal po wala po silang sweldo," said Airey Alano, Atimonan Tourism Officer. "May mga ilan po tayong byahero na nagmamabuting loob pong mag-abot ng kaunting barya." 

On Labor Day, the GMA Kapuso Foundation offered free medical services to the traffic volunteers, farmers, and tour guides in Atimonan. 

These include free consultations, X-ray, ECG, fasting blood sugar (FBS) test, and medicines. They also received food packs, vitamins, and clothes, while Kapuso volunteer artists kept them entertained. 

"ECG, nakikita natin diyan 'yung mga basic abnormalities dun sa ating puso. X-ray makikita natin diyan kung tayo ay may mga sakit sa baga. HbA1c, ito ay nakikita mo kung over the past three months ang iyong blood sugar ay controlled," said Dr. Joanna Advincula-Illiligay, chief of hospital at the Quezon Province Hospital Network Doña Marta.
